FORT WAYNE, Ind. (ADAMS) – The Fort Wayne Police Department says that a man is now facing charges after he allegedly shot his pregnant wife. On Monday,
Officers with the FWPD were initially called to the 4000 block of Nadina Cove around 12:30 p.m. where they found a woman who had been shot. She was taken to the hospital where physicians said her condition was life-threatening.
The FWPD initially released the following:
The Fort Wayne Police Department is investigating a shooting that occurred April 15th, 2024 at roughly 12:34 PM at a residence on the 4000 block of Nadina CV. FWPD officers located an adult female suffering from an apparent gunshot wound at the residence. She was rendered care and transported to a local hospital by TRAA in critical condition. While at the hospital she was downgraded to life threatening condition. FWPD officers detained an adult male at the scene and he is being interviewed by Detectives. It is unknown at this time the circumstances leading to the shooting.
This incident remains under investigation by the Fort Wayne Police Department and the Allen County Prosecutor’s Office.
Police said on Tuesday that 25-year-old Terry Lee Sowles Jr. was also at the residence and was arrested and released the following:
Terry Lee Sowles Jr. was arrested in connection to the shooting that occurred at a residence on the 4000 block of Nadina Cove on April 15th, 2024 around 12:34 PM. He was detained by police at the scene and arrested after he was interviewed by detectives on April 15th, 2024 at roughly 4:26 PM.
Suspect Arrested #1: Terry Lee Sowles Jr.; 25 years of age
Preliminary Charges: Domestic Battery in presence of a Child, Level 6 Felony; Aggravated Battery, Level 3 Felony; Criminal Recklessness with a Deadly Weapon, Level 6 Felony; Domestic Battery Causing Bodily Injury to a Pregnant Woman, Level 5 Felony; Domestic Battery Causing Serious Bodily Injury, Level 5 Felony; and Domestic Battery with a Deadly Weapon, Level 5 Felony.
